节点应用在Google Cloud App Engine上侦听低于1024的端口

时间:2016-10-05 21:20:39

标签: node.js google-app-engine google-compute-engine google-cloud-platform

我创建了一个app引擎,它运行一个节点应用程序,提供一些html,css和javascript。

我希望我的节点应用程序监听端口443.但是如果我在8080以外的端口上运行它,我的节点应用程序会出现503错误

我在网上搜索并认为有一项接受客户的服务'端口80上的请求(我不知道服务在哪里运行)。此服务将这些请求重定向到虚拟机的8080端口。这是运行我的节点应用程序的虚拟机。

如果我错了,请纠正我。

那么如何更改该服务的配置以将传入请求重定向到端口443上的应用程序?

1 个答案:

答案 0 :(得分:3)

您的应用必须 handle requests via port 8080。如果您尝试使用端口443,我猜您正在尝试提供SSL。您可以在App Engine Flexible(运行Node.js的地方)herehere中找到有关如何执行此操作的详细信息。